  • Abstract
    We report on the status of the work towards cold strontium clock in the Polish National Laboratory of AMO Physics in Torun. The system consists of: (1) a Zeeman slower and magneto-optical traps (at 461 nm and 689 nm), (2) a frequency comb, and (3) a narrow-band laser coupled to an ultra-stable optical cavity. So far, all parts of the experiment are working and the whole system is tested at the 1S0-3P1, 689 nm optical transition in 88Sr atoms with 7 kHz linewidth.
